Commission submits motion to dismiss three judges

On December 18, 2023, the Panel of the High Qualification Commission of Judges of Ukraine, at its meeting, considered the issue of submitting a motion to the High Council of Justice to dismiss a judge from his or her position.

Based on the results of the qualification evaluation, three judges were found to not correspond to the position held. The Commission decided to submit a motion to the HCJ for dismissal:

Two judges were recognized as corresponding to the position held

On December 14, 2023, the Panel of the High Qualification Commission of Judges of Ukraine, at its meeting, held interviews and determined the results of the qualification evaluation of two local court judges for their compliance with the position held.

Based on the results of the qualification evaluation for the compliance with the position held, the Commission made the following decisions:

Members of the Commission Liudmyla Volkova and Nadiia Kobetska took part in judge trainings in Poland

On December 5 and 6, 2023, the National School of Judges of Ukraine and the Programme “Competence Development for the Legal Sector of Ukraine” jointly organised an offsite training for judges on war crimes in Poland, which was attended by members of the Commission Liudmyla Volkova and Nadiia Kobetska.

Members of the Commission took part in the Roundtable “Judicial integrity and professional ethics: standards and practice of evaluation”

On November 24 and 25, 2023, the Roundtable “Judicial integrity and professional ethics: standards and practice of evaluation” was held in Kyiv. The High Qualification Commission of Judges of Ukraine was represented by the Secretary of the First Chamber of the HQCJ Ruslan Melnyk, and members of the Commission Vitalii Gatseliuk and Oleh Koliush.
